How does North Springfield, VT compare to Albany, VT? North Springfield has a population of 432 with a median household income of $67,290, while Albany has 161 residents and a median income of $96,250.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| North Springfield, VT | Albany, VT |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 432 | 161 | +168.3% |
| Median Age | 60.5 | 42.9 | +41.0% |
| Foreign Born % | 11.3% | 0% | +1130.0% |
| Metric | North Springfield | Albany |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$67,290 | $96,250 | -30.1% |
| Unemployment | 0% | 1.2% | -100.0% |
| Poverty Rate | 0% | 3.1% | -100.0% |
| Bachelor's+ | 17.8% | 40% | -55.5% |
